Campsite information

Accommodations

  • Pitches for tourists: 76
  • Pitches parceled: 76
  • Pitches for permanent campers: 68
  • Rental accommodations: 2
  • Rentals with sanitary facilities: 2

Measurements

  • Total size of the campsite: 2 ha
  • Size of the pitches: 65 - 90 m²
  • Meters above sea level: 1 m

Surrounding area

  • Nearest city: Den Helder
  • Nearest town/village center: Julianadorp (in 2 km)
  • Public transport stop: (in 2 km)

Site

Flat grassland interspersed with low hedges in a rural setting. Possible noise impact from nearby military airport. Located between the outskirts of the village and fields.

Family-Friendly Campsite, Very Clean and Right by the Sea

Very good8

Sandra

June 2017

We have been regularly going to this campsite with our children and dog for 3 years and are very satisfied! The site is not particularly large, but you only have to cross the main road (traffic lights) to immediately reach a dune access to the sea. There are 2 large sanitary facilities that are very clean at any time of the day. In the entrance area, there are washbasins and sinks. For the children, there is a playground with bouncy pillows. For a fee, you can also wash and dry your laundry on site. Whether with a caravan, tent, or motorhome... you can have a great holiday here. Additionally, they offer 2 converted wooden wagons (very pretty and cute) and also 2 wooden huts for rent. Only the power grid is a bit sensitive, and it can happen that it occasionally fails if too many people need electricity at the same time (e.g., for cooking). Those who can live with this drawback are well taken care of here, especially since the problem is immediately solved if you inform the owner on site. Our children love this place because you can quickly make friends, and dogs are very welcome there. The beach is very clean and spacious, and even during the peak season, you can always find a free spot! Prices are very reasonable and family-friendly. The surroundings also offer plenty of excursion destinations and activities when the weather is not so great. There are also great routes for cyclists. You can find a bike rental "just around the corner". We are already looking forward to next year...
